While the police are still battling to arrest the culprits behind the shooting of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) ward chairman, Charles Oke, in Ogbaku, Mbaitoli council area of Imo State, last the weekend, a High Court was also been razed by the hoodlums on Sunday.
A source from the area disclosed that the gunmen stormed the court located inside the Oguta Local Government at about 11pm and set it on fire.
The source, who didn’t want his name to be mentioned, said the Magistrate’s Court Registry, Appeal Court Record Office, File Room, Secretary to the High Court Judge’s office, office of the High Court bailiff and the Chamber of the High Court Judge were badly affected.
Another source from the community, who confirmed the incident to Daily Sun, said: “Yes,it’s true. I saw with my own eyes, the incident happened on Sunday night; but we thank God no life was lost in the fire.”
